For future reference you should have estoppel forms filled out by current tenants as well as a clause in the contract that the owner will not make any changes to leases or admit new tenants after the contract is signed.You could check your insurance policy to see if pit bulls is against the policy in which case you could give them notice that it violates your insurance and they have 30 days to cure or move out.
